Foxton Train Station ensures your ticketing experience is hassle-free with its user-friendly ticket machines. While there isn't a ticket office, you can easily collect your pre-purchased tickets from these machines. They're designed to accommodate all passengers, including those using the Disabled Persons Railcard.
As part of its commitment to accessibility, the station offers step-free access to both platforms via short ramps and a level crossing, ensuring ease of use for all travelers. Assistance is readily available through the help points located on platforms, and with CCTV monitoring, you're assured of a safe environment at all times.
Foxton Train Station is designed with accessibility in mind. While it offers step-free access to certain parts, passengers with mobility challenges should take note that station staff can provide assistance when necessary. Although there are no waiting rooms or toilets, there is a seating area where passengers can rest while waiting for their trains. It's worth noting that trains calling at this station do not have onboard staff, though help is available through customer action points p s and phone services.

The station is equipped with essential amenities, ensuring a smooth travel experience. While there's no ticket office service on Sundays, travelers can use the convenient ticket machines available daily. For online ticket purchases, collection is a breeze using these machines. Accessibility is a key feature at the station, with step-free access throughout and designated areas for those with mobility impairments.
Although there are no toilets or shopping facilities on-site, the station ensures safety and comfort with seating areas, CCTV cameras, and customer help points available. For cyclists, there are ample bicycle storage facilities, including the option to hire a Brompton bike, perfect for exploring the town and its surroundings.
Henley-on-Thames station offers numerous onward travel options. Whether you're catching a bus, hailing a taxi, or considering hiring a bicycle, you'll find convenient services to suit your needs. For air travelers, links are available via nearby Reading station, connecting to Heathrow and Gatwick airports.
